This one above is what most of us would call “exotic”. Not so much for its shape, but mostly because you won’t see many of them on the street. It is a Monteverdi 375 S Berlinetta. It was built from 1969 to 1973 and was powered with a V8 from Chrysler with 7.2 Liters or 440 cubic inches. Monteverdi was a Swiss manufacturer of luxury sport cars and was based close to the city of Basel in Switzerland. The founder, Peter Monteverdi, started working at his Dad’s repair shop, specialized in Ferrari, BMW and Lancia. He started production of his own cars by 1967. After some interesting cars (including what we now call SUV, based on the International Harvester Scout) they closed production by 1984.

I love this Volvo! When you think of Volvo, specially station wagons, you think of massive, rather square cars. And while this car isn’t really small or “delicate”, it has some nice rounding here and there – specially the front, with this rather elegant grille. This is a Volvo 145 from the 70’s – I guess something like 1972 or 1973.
